Crude oil futures up on firm overseas cues

NEW DELHI, July 16:  Crude oil futures prices today rose marginally by 0.13 per cent to Rs 6,293 per barrel as speculators enlarged positions, tracking a firming trend in the Asian region.
At the Multi Commodity Exchange, crude oil prices for delivery in July traded Rs 8, or 0.13 per cent higher at Rs 6,293 per barrel, with a business turnover of 2,058 lots.
The crude oil prices for August also up by Rs 4, or 0.06 per cent, to Rs 6,283 per barrel, with a business volume of 547 lots.
Market analysts said the rise in crude oil futures attributed to a firming trend in Asia as investors anticipated a fall in US crude inventories for the third straight week, renewing hopes of resurgent demand.
Meanwhile, West Texas Intermediate crude prices for August delivery gained eight cents to USD 106.40 a barrel on the New York Mercantile Exchange. (PTI)
